Whether you're exploring paintings to contribute to your expanding art collection or simply trying to find out more about art as a whole, you may be wondering about the differing kinds of paint media you see on labels in museums, galleries, and internet sites. To aid make clear, we have actually compiled a listing of the key sorts of paint you might see listed next to contemporary and historical paints.

Oil paint is made with finely-crushed pigments and drying out seed or vegetable oils - most typically linseed. The medium is thought to have been used throughout background, yet ended up being commonly utilized throughout the Northern and Italian Renaissance periods. Oil paint dries out very slowly, which means that musicians can mix paints straight on the canvas, and have to wait time periods for layers to completely dry prior to going on to the next stage in their paint procedure.

Acrylic paint is a more current advancement in the paint world as compared to oil paint. Polymer paint is a water-based paint so it dries out much faster than oils, and makes use of water as a thinning representative while oils require turpentine or alternative paint slimmers. Because of this, musicians can function faster and the products posture less threat (to breathe and touch).

Watercolor paint integrates finely-ground shade pigments mixed with a water-soluble binding material (this generally contains gum, sugar, glycerine, and moistening representatives - per Tate Modern's glossary). Watercolor paint is usually repainted on details paper instead than canvas or board, and has a semi-transparent quality and quick drying time. Watercolor paper might require to be stretched, which involves entirely wetting the paper and after that drying it before paint in order to stop undesirable wrinkling.

It can take considerable technique to discover just how to adjust watercolor paint. Watercolor paintings are frequently done in layers, likewise to acrylic and oil paintings, and have fast drying times like acrylics. Understanding the linked strategies may take trial and mistake, yet generates a wonderful, washy finish.
